The Tenroy Shape Forming Punch and Dies are precision-engineered metal stamping tools designed for high-performance applications in automotive and appliance manufacturing. Crafted from SKD11 steel and stainless steel, these moulds combine durability with precision, enabling reliable production of complex components like RJ45 connectors and automotive parts.
